(Genesis 24 v 15)
It was quite an adventure for Abraham's servant, and the gravity of his task had not escaped him.
Finding a wife for his master's son was a tall order.
But he did not go on the instruction alone, to "get a wife for my son Isaac" ( v 4 )
He prayed as well.
To the "God of my master Abraham?" ( V 12 )
So, it seems, there was no close relationship
But he had witnessed his master prosper under the gracious hand of this God whom he feared - enough to pray to.
And as he was laying out his terms for knowing if this was the right place, person etc
In fact "before he had finished praying" ( V 15 ) out she came.
Rebekah.
The gift was already being delivered even before the request was completed.
